Parents are going to be the people kids grow up around and spend the most time with. The area they grow up around and the people they interact with are all they know. That's why in school, they teach children not to bully, do drugs, break the law or hurt other people. They attempt to give the child a better environment to live around, so they would know those things are wrong and will become a good person. But still, some people do it anyways, and that's because their parents probably did those things. When a child gets hurt, who do they run to for help? Their parents. When a child needs some advice, who do they go to? Their parents. If a child feels alone, who do they go to? Their parents. Children look up to their parents and trust them to be there for them. Parents shape their kids into a person who acts like themselves. If parents bully, do drugs, break the law or hurt other people, their kids will be convinced it's okay and will follow their parent's footsteps. A good kid and a bad kid can grow up in the same good school, but the bad kid is bad because of family problems. It's so so so important for parents to be good role models because who they are is who their kids will turn out to be.
